Company Structure
Most organisations have hierarchical or pyramidal structure, with one person or a group of people at the top, and an increasing number of people below them at each successive level. There is a clear line or chain of command running down the (21) All the people in the organisation know what decisions they are able to (22) , who their superior is.
Some people in an organisation have colleagues who help them: for example, there might be an Assistant to the Marketing Manager. This is known as a staff position: its holder has no line (23) , and is not integrated into the chain of command, unlike, for example, the Assistant Marketing Manager, who is number two in the marketing department.
Yet the activities of most companies are too complicated to be (24) in a single hierarchy. Shortly before the First World War, the French industrialist Henry Fayol organised his coal-mining business according to the (25) that it had to carry out, He is generally credited with (26) functional organisation. Today, most large manufacturing organisations have a functional structure, including production, finance, marketing, sales, and personnel or human resources department. This means, for example, that the production and marketing departments cannot make financial decisions (27) consulting the finance department.
Functional organisation is efficient, but there are two standard criticisms. Firstly, people are usually more (28) with the success of their department than that of the company, so there are permanent battles between, for example, finance and marketing, or marketing and production, which have (29) goals. Secondly, separating functions is (30) to encourage innovation.
